Neal, Charles M.

Neal, Charles M. age 68. Chuck was a resident of Minnetonka for 30 years, and Director of the Male Chorus at Fellowship Missionary Baptist Church in Mpls, MN.

Chuck died on June 24, 2011 of a brain aneurysm in Abbot Northwestern Hospital.

Born in Jacksonville, Florida and raised in North Philadelphia, Chuck earned a B.A. degree from LaSalle University in 1965, and a MBA from Drexel University in 1981.

He completed Navy OCS and served as a 2nd Lieutenant airborne navigator. Chuck taught 9th grade science in Philadelphia public schools.

In 1969 Chuck started his life-long commitment to Honeywell where he became the first Black director for field sales marketing, as well the youngest of the 5 regional directors at age 37.

He leaves to cherish his memory: his son, Michael, 7 grandchildren, 4 siblings, and a host of relatives and friends.
